Abstract
The present invention relates to building fields, more particularly to a kind of coupling type foot pedal of self-locking, it includes foot pedal ontology and the side box set on foot pedal ontology both ends, the foot pedal ontology includes the plug division at bottom plate and both ends, the side box includes box body, the box body includes the plugboard being set on the inside of box body, the position for being biased to one end on the outside of the box body along the middle part of box body extending direction is equipped with the arc slide plate being connect with box body by step rivet, the middle part of the arc slide plate is equipped with and the mutually matched sliding slot of step rivet, the both sides of arc slide plate are respectively equipped with the square hook that Open Side Down on the box body, the opposite side that arcuately slide plate is biased on the outside of the box body is equipped with balance and blocks, it is opposite that the side box balance card at foot pedal ontology both ends is biased to direction.Device provided by the invention is easy to operate, easy for installation, securely and reliably, and can realize self-locking.

Technical field
The present invention relates to building field more particularly to a kind of coupling type foot pedals of self-locking.
Background technology
During building engineering construction, since working at height generally requires to set up scaffold, and needed between scaffold
Foot pedal is laid with to form working space, for operating personnel's activity and the transport of labor and materials, between foot pedal and scaffold
Connect it is most important, it is careless slightly to can cause casualties or property loss, between existing foot pedal and scaffold
Connection can not achieve self-locking, when foot pedal is due to the excessive or unbalance stress of heavy burden, it is most likely that cause foot pedal and scaffold
Transverse tube be detached from, generation personnel such as fall at the serious consequences.

Specific implementation mode
In order to make those skilled in the art more fully understand technical scheme of the present invention, below in conjunction with the accompanying drawings and most
The present invention is described in further detail for good embodiment.
As shown, a kind of coupling type foot pedal of self-locking comprising foot pedal ontology 1 and be set to foot pedal ontology both ends
Side box, the foot pedal ontology includes the plug division 10 at bottom plate 9 and both ends, and the side box includes box body 3, and the box body includes
Plugboard 8 on the inside of box body, the position that one end is biased in the box body outside along the middle part of box body extending direction, which is equipped with, to be passed through
The middle part of the arc slide plate 5 that step rivet 11 is connect with box body, the arc slide plate is equipped with and the mutually matched cunning of step rivet
Slot 6, the both sides of arc slide plate are respectively equipped with the square hook 4 that Open Side Down on the box body, are arcuately slided on the outside of the box body
For the opposite side that piece is biased to equipped with balance card 7, the side box balance card deviation direction at foot pedal ontology both ends is opposite.
The middle part of the foot pedal ontology bottom plate is equipped with V-arrangement reinforcing rib 2 along extending direction.
When installation, the plugboard of side box is inserted into foot pedal plug division, and intersection area is welded, and square hook is hung
Onto scaffold transverse tube, when starting mounting, transverse tube contacts the lower part of arc slide plate, and arc slide plate will be along on sliding slot
It moves, and when transverse tube reaches peak and blocked with hook, slide plate will slide and hold transverse tube automatically, form self-locking, prevent side box
Be detached from transverse tube, balance card just blocks the top of transverse tube at this time, prevents foot pedal from turning on one's side, make foot pedal and scaffold it
Between connection it is more safe and reliable.
